I am working alongside a leading groundworks engineering contractor who are currently looking to hire an experienced Site Engineer in Manchester due to a number of new contracts being awarded.
Site Engineer responsibilities
- Setting out using total station. Works include setting out groundworks, drainage, external works and foundations.
- Working alongside the project management team.
- Ensuring health and safety compliance.
- Ensuring works are being carried out in accordance to agreed methodology and method.
- Ensuring the correct documentation is held on site.
- Ensuring works are completed on time and to specification.
Site Engineer requirements
- Experience with setting out groundworks, drainage, external works and foundations.
- Drivers License.
- Right to work in the UK.
- CSCS Card.
- Strong communication skills.
